摘要: 在运用质量屋进行前期产品需求规划的过程中,为解决多约束条件下的技术特征配置问题,对传统质量屋的结构进行改造,提出基于满意度与投入约束的需求规划决策模型。该模型通过分析以公理化信息距离为基础的满意度量化法,综合考虑多种投入约束下的配置条件,运用整数规划求解的方法得到产品需求规划的技术特征配置。以自动贩卖机为实例,对该方法进行了应用验证。

Abstract: In the process of product requirement pre-planning by using House of Quality (HoQ),to solve the technical characteristics configuration under multi-constraint condition,the traditional HoQ structure was reformed,and a requirement planning decision model based on satisfaction and input-constraint was proposed.Through analyzed the quantitative method of satisfaction based on axiomatic information distance,the technical characteristics configuration of product requirement planning was obtained by considering the multiple input-constraint configuration condition and adopting the method of integer programming solving.The proposed method was validated through performing a case study of coin machine.
